After a rate-cut rally, markets stalled as attention shifted to U.S.-China trade talks. Stock futures for Dow Jones, S&P 500, and Nasdaq 100 were flat. Small-caps led Thursday’s gains, with Russell 2000 up 2.5% to a record high. Tech stocks surged, with Intel benefiting from Nvidia’s $5 billion investment partnership.
